Nicaragua has been called the “land of lakes and volcanoes,” but problems continue to erupt.   Thick rainforests, rugged highlands, long beaches, and fertile hills define the country’s beautiful landscape. Nicaragua’s rich history dates back to the Spanish conquistadores.    Many species of birds and animals thrive in this diverse climate, but the people of Nicaragua are not thriving.   Nicaragua is the poorest nation in Central America. Just across our border, thousands of Mexicans live in makeshift houses constructed from materials they gathered at the city dump.  Many of them have migrated to Matamoros because of its position at the southernmost tip of Texas.  They expect to work in American owned factories, but many do not find work at all. On March 11, 2011 a massive earthquake hit the coast of Japan, devastating the Island nation.  It ripped through northeast Kyushu, spawning a series of frighteningly powerful tsunamis that dealt even more devastation. The epicenter of the quake, which was recorded at a record 8.9 and later revised to 9.0, was the largest ever in Japan and the fifth most powerful in the world, costing over 18,000 lives.
